Charges Dropped Against One Man in Zodiac Lounge Shooting

MACON, Georgia (41NBC/WMGT) – Charges were dismissed for one of the men accused in the Zodiac Lounge shooting, and according to Macon Police the incident was caught on camera.

According to police, 27-year-old Jarrett Taylor was released from the Bibb County Law Enforcement Center on Friday. Taylor was one of the eight people charged with criminal attempt to commit murder and participation in street gang activity. The charges stem from the July 5 night club shooting which left three people injured and a teenager dead.

41NBC spoke with Taylor Wednesday and he declined to go on camera. However, Taylor says he is innocent and was not at the Zodiac Lounge at the time of the shooting.

John Michael Hollingshed, who was arrested Tuesday at the Value Place hotel in Columbus, is accused of shooting Deon Davis eight times at close range, according to the arrest warrant. The warrant added that Hollingshed passed the gun to another murder suspect, Andre Bonner. Bonner is named as the gunman who shot 17-year-old Jammoni Bland five times, killing the teenager.

According to the arrest warrant, Hollingshed can be seen on the surveillance video shooting Davis.
